Gingrich soars to top of new WWL-TV poll on GOP presidential race in La.
Dennis Woltering and Dominic Massa / Eyewitness News NEW ORLEANS — A new Eyewitness News poll reveals Newt Gingrich has taken a big lead in the race for the Republican presidential nomination in Louisiana. Gingrich, the former House Speaker, scores 31 percent in the poll. Former Massachusetts governor Mitt Romney earns 23 percent, while businessman Herman Cain scores 12 percent and Texas …

Cal Dive to Present at Capital One Southcoast 6th Annual Energy Conference
HOUSTON–(BUSINESS WIRE)–Cal Dive International, Inc. (NYSE:DVR) announced today that it will present at the Capital One Southcoast 6th Annual Energy Conference on Wednesday, December 7, 2011 at the Omni Royal Orleans, in New Orleans, LA. The presentation will begin at 9:40 a.m. (Central Time). Audio of the presentation will be broadcast live from http://wsw.com/webcast/cof3/dvr/.
